This year Cycling CHB are pleased to announce that for the 28th Anniversary there will again be a Festival of Cycling again which will take place over 2 days on the 23rd & 24th January 2021. MTB CANCELLED SORRY. PLEASE SEE BELOW FOR FURTHER
The festival will see riders take on the Bay Motorcycles, Mountain Biking on Saturday 23rd starting at Russell Park, incorparating the new Gum Tree MTB tracks. This will be followed by the 28th Hatuma Cafe Tour de Beautiful around the beautiful Central Hawke's Bay, incorporating scenic views from country to coast (new course), which will start and finish from CHB College on the Sunday.
Along with the new MTB courses and events, riders will have a chance to compete for prize money and spot prizes throughout the weekend. 2021 will also see the option of an E-Bike options for the majourity of the both courses.
You could be the next Tough Guy/ Gal (Long Courses) or Not-So Tough Guy/Gal (Short Courses) or Future Tough Boy/Girl (Junior Short Courses) by entering both days events.
You can pick up your registration packs at Russell Park on Saturday 23rd January, from 8am (MTB & Tough only), CHB College from 4pm - 6pm and Sunday 24th January, from 7am - 8.30am at CHB College.
Food and coffee stalls will be available on site both days.
MTB = Saturday 23rd January 2021, starting at 9am from Russell Park, Waipukurau
Tour de Beautiful = Sunday 24th January 2021, starting from 9am from CHB College Waipukurau.
All entries received for the Tour de Beautiful prior to Friday 15th January 2021 will receive a free lunch so enter early . PLEASE NOTE: lunch is for Sunday 24th only.
PLEASE NOTE:
The CHB Cycling Club decided at their latest meeting that due to insufficient entries, the Bay Motorcycles MTB Race as part of the Tour de Beautiful festival of cycling, is cancelled for 2021.
The committee, would like to thank you for your support in entering the event and hope that you will be back to race with us in 2022. The Hatuma Cafe Road Race on Sunday the 24th of January is still going ahead with strong numbers.
A full refund of entry fee will be made in due course. If you would like to transfer your ride to the road race on the Sunday, then please contact organisors. If you were entered in both the MTB race and the road race as a Tough Guy/Gal or Not-so Tough Guy/Gal, then you are still welcome to participate on the Sunday and part of your entry fee will be refunded to you.
